Effect of Spatial Correlations on the Electronic Properties of A_3B_5 Quaternary Nitrogen-Containing Solid Solutions

摘要

The short-range order in solid solutions of A_3B_5 semiconductors is investigated within the valence force field approximation.It is demonstrated that these solutions are characterized by specific types of short-range order,such as one-dimensional chains composed of nitrogen atoms along the [100] and [110] directions and In_2Ga_2 tetrahedra centered at nitrogen atoms.The main contribution to a considerable decrease in the band gap is made by a shift of states at the GAMMA point.This shift is associated only with the nitrogen atoms and does not depend on their local environment.The contribution from the interaction of different bands changes the localization of the wave function and depends strongly on the type of short-range order.
